At Middlestown Primary Academy we take great pride in educating children in a friendly, challenging, exciting and purposeful environment. We work with determination to help all children achieve their potential. Due to an internal promotion, we currently have a vacancy for a Teaching Assistant / Higher Level Teaching Assistant to join our support team.

The successful candidate will work as a Teaching Assistant, supporting the teaching and learning in the classroom, under the direction of teaching staff. You will also work as a Higher-Level Teaching Assistant, covering PPA of class teachers. This is a rewarding role where you will work collaboratively with teaching staff to assist teachers in the whole planning cycle and management of the class. You will be required to have the ability to use your own initiative when responding to the needs of individual children, and excellent interpersonal skills.

Candidates are welcome to apply for either or both positions. Please indicate this within your application form.

The position is on a part-time basis working Monday to Friday 9.00am to 12.00pm, and 1.00pm to 3.15pm, with a non-working afternoon on a Thursday.
